Peculiarities of nuclear reactions induced by ultracold neutrons passing through thin films

Description
The probabilities of elastic scattering and capture of ultracold neutrons in thin films are calculated in terms of the time quantum theory. It is shown that at a neutron wavelength exceeding considerably the film thickness the macroscopic probability of the (n, γ) reaction can decrease as compared with the macroscopic probability of elastic scattering. 7 refs
